Is this betting site legitimate? (Legality & Safety)
Bet99 Ontario operates under a full license from the Alcohol and Gaming Commission of Ontario (AGCO), the provincial regulator overseeing iGaming in Ontario since the market opened in 2022. This places it in a strong regulatory jurisdiction with strict standards for fairness, player protection, and financial stability—no weak offshore licensing here. The site is geo-blocked outside Ontario to comply with legal restrictions, requiring users to be 19+ and physically located in the province; attempts to access from restricted areas like other Canadian provinces or international locations result in blocked registration.
Ownership details are not publicly disclosed in depth, typical for many AGCO licensees focused on operations rather than brand backstory, but the platform emphasizes Canadian-centric features without ties to larger international conglomerates. Security includes standard SSL encryption for data transmission, account lockouts after failed logins, and optional two-factor authentication (2FA) via app or SMS, though not mandated. KYC verification kicks in during first withdrawal or large deposits, requiring government ID, proof of address, and sometimes a selfie with ID; common friction includes delays if documents are unclear, averaging 24-48 hours for approval.
Community signals show mostly positive sentiment for payouts and fairness, but some disputes surface around promo terms and account limits after winning streaks—patterns like these are common industry-wide and handled via AGCO escalation if unresolved. No major red flags like mass payout failures or license revocations appear in regulator records or forums.
Why it matters: AGCO licensing ensures segregated player funds and independent audits, reducing insolvency risk, while robust KYC prevents fraud but can slow first payouts. Bettors avoid these sites if quick, no-questions access is key, as compliance prioritizes safety over speed.
Sportsbook Coverage & Betting Markets
Bet99 Ontario covers over 30 sports, with heavy emphasis on North American favorites like NHL, NBA, NFL, MLB, and CFL alongside soccer (EPL, MLS), tennis, and basketball. League depth shines in major competitions—expect 100+ markets per NHL game including player props like shots on goal or save percentages. Niche options include esports (CS:GO, League of Legends), darts, snooker, and water polo, though less depth than mainstream sports. Live betting spans most events with stable streaming, and bet limits start at $0.50 minimum stake, max payouts capped at $100,000 per slip. Odds display in decimal format by default, with easy switches to fractional or American, tailored for Ontario users.
Odds quality & value (pricing)
Odds value is assessed via overround (house margin), typically 4-6% on major markets, competitive with Ontario peers. For example, in an EPL match like Manchester United vs. Arsenal, Bet99 offers 1X2 at 2.10/3.60/3.50 (overround ~5.2%), slightly better than bet365's 2.05/3.50/3.60 (~5.5%) due to sharper props. On NFL totals (e.g., Chiefs vs. Bills O/U 48.5), lines hit 1.91/1.91 vs. DraftKings' 1.87/1.95, favoring value sharps. Asian Handicaps on soccer average -0.5 at 1.95/1.95, strong for accumulators.
Odds boosts apply to select parlays (e.g., +20% on 4-leg NFL), adding short-term value but not altering base margins long-term. Casual bettors benefit from straightforward moneylines, while high-volume players gain from early lines on Stanley Cup futures, often posted first among Ontario books.
Live betting features (in-play)
Live markets update rapidly across 20+ sports daily, with NFL offering standout streaming for bet-placed games (past 10 minutes eligibility). Cash out is available on nearly all markets—full or partial—with limitations during final minutes or high-volatility props. Bet Builder supports NFL/NHL same-game parlays up to 10 legs, intuitive drag-and-drop interface but excludes some player combos.
Streaming quality is HD for NFL/tennis/soccer, geo-locked to Ontario, no extra cost. Latency is low (under 5 seconds), but markets suspend briefly on goals/red cards, minimally disrupting flow.

Bonus code terms that actually matter (deep T&Cs breakdown)
Welcome First Bet Encore: Min deposit $10, min odds 1.50 on singles/accas, eligible on sports (excludes virtuals/esports promos). Rollover: 1x on free bet at 1.50+ odds, 7-day window. Max bonus $800 matching first bet loss. Max stake equals deposit. Voids/cash-outs forfeit bonus; free bets are stake not returned (SNR), winnings paid cash. Expiry: Free bet 7 days. No e-wallet exclusions noted. KYC required pre-withdrawal.
Reload/Acca Boost: Code via email/SMS, min deposit $20, 10% profit boost on 5+ leg accas at 2.00+ avg odds, max $100 boost, 30-day expiry, sports only (no props excluded explicitly).
Parlay Insurance: Code optional, refund up to $50 as free bet if 4+ leg loses by one, min odds 1.30/leg, 1x rollover.
General: Bonus funds convert 1:1 after rollover; max withdrawal post-bonus unlimited but daily limits apply.
Bonus code real value: practical examples
Example 1: Conservative $100 deposit. Deposit $100, bet on EPL match at 2.00 odds (qualifies). If loses, get $100 free bet. Wager free bet on NBA O/U at 1.80 (meets min), win $80 profit (SNR). Total potential: $180 return from $100 risk. Why it matters: SNR reduces value vs stake-included (effective 50% less on wins), but low 1x rollover makes it accessible; expiry risk high if not bet quickly—ideal for casuals planning 2-3 wagers.
Example 2: Max aggressive $800 first bet. Deposit $800, bet NFL parlay at 2.50 odds. Loses: $800 free bet. Split into two $400 bets at 1.70 odds, win both for $680 profit. Real value ~$680 vs headline $800 due to SNR. Why it matters: High rollers gain scale, but void rules (e.g., player prop cashed out) erase it; track 7-day window to avoid total loss—suits live bettors chaining markets.

Betting rules & policies that can affect your money
Settlement follows official results, voids on abandons (full refund), resettles if errors. Cash out unavailable last 5-10% of events or props. Account limits trigger post-wins (stake caps, promo bans), multi-accounting (same household/IP) leads to closures. AML flags suspicious patterns (e.g., round bets), requiring proof. Responsible tools: daily/weekly limits, cool-off (24h-7d), self-exclusion via Connex (permanent).
